    One of the first comments we hear from our homeowners after finishing a project is, “The renovation has made our life so much easier!” New cabinets are a big reason for this enthusiastic response. Wood Wise carries KraftMaid and Waypoint cabinets. Both lines offer multiple features that help with organization and ease of use. Some of these features include: convenient appliance storage, roll-out shelves, multi-storage pantry solutions making better use of all the space available, drawers with cutlery dividers, pull-out knife section and much more. Full-extension soft-close drawers provide easy access to contents. Wall cabinets feature adjustable shelves for maximum storage capacity. Our cabinet showroom allows you to see and experience these features.

    Magazines show remodeling as improved appearances. Sometimes homes need performance updates. Homes built before 1990 may have builder-basic windows, the lowest performing on the market. New windows seal out drafts, operate smoothly, tilt in for easy cleaning and have a Low-E coating to bounce body heat back into the room.

    Homes have parts that wear out. Replacing your refrigerator is more of a performance upgrade than a new look. Refrigerators built before 2014 consume 25% more electricity than a new Energy Savings model. Plus the shelving is easy to clean and adjust. New refrigerators use 1/5 as much electricity as 1970’s models.

    Last year Wood Wise replaced all of Mike and Jean Carter’s kitchen cabinets (above). While the new cabinets look great it is their outstanding performance that they are celebrating. Pots and pans roll out with lids on in deep, full-extension drawers. Pantry cabinet shelves roll out to make life easy. Great performance while cooking and putting away groceries adds to their home enjoyment.

    This homeowner was ready for a change in the master bathroom. The dated wallpaper and garden tub were removed and a fresh new style has been added. The KraftMaid Lyndale style cherry cabinets are paired with Santa Cecilia granite countertops. The large shower features a half wall with porcelain tile and a racing stripe. A window seat, new large tile floor, lighting and mirrors make the room look and feel great.

    Wood Wise has made a donation towards the construction of a bus shelter for the Healing Place of Wake County. Many of the clients of the Healing Place don’t have cars so riding the bus is their only option to look for jobs and take skills classes. The shelter will provide protection from the weather using recycled materials. Architect firm BBH Design has provided the design and is helping to raise money for construction. Wood Wise is pleased to be a part of this worthy project.
